Secret.Service.prototype.store_sync
function store_sync(schema: Secret.Schema, attributes: {String: String}, collection: String, label: String, value: Secret.Value, cancellable: Gio.Cancellable): Boolean { // Gjs wrapper for secret_service_store_sync() }
Store a secret value in the secret service.
The attributes should be a set of key and value string pairs.
If the attributes match a secret item already stored in the collection, then the item will be updated with these new values.
If collection is null, then the default collection will be used. Use #SECRET_COLLECTION_SESSION to store the password in the session collection, which doesn't get stored across login sessions.
If service is NULL, then Secret.Service.get_sync will be called to get the default Secret.Service proxy.
This method may block indefinitely and should not be used in user interface threads.
- schema
the schema for the attributes
- attributes
the attribute keys and values
- collection
a collection alias, or D-Bus object path of the collection where to store the secret
- label
label for the secret
- value
the secret value
- cancellable
optional cancellation object
- Returns
whether the storage was successful or not
